Indian parties scramble to woo tuned-out young voters

Youths will play a catalytic role in determining who comes to power

NEW DELHI -- Indian political parties are scrambling to woo youths in the ongoing general election, in which Prime Minister Narendra Modi is seeking a third five-year term. Party workers are leveraging the power of social media, music videos and grassroots organizations as well as Bollywood stars to lure the country's sizable youth demographic into polling booths.
